Description

The case examines the scope, history, and scale of the fintech industry, while also defining what fintech may be?and what it is not. The protagonist, management consultant Carolina Costa, is tasked to advise a client bank executive regarding alternative paths into fintech that he could choose. The material includes an overview of the fintech market, including analysis of entrants from start-up incubators, banks, and technology companies. The case figures and exhibits provide data to allow students to analyze the current market saturation and consumer needs in regard to fintech products. This case was designed for a second-year MBA elective course on financial institutions and markets but can also be taught in a first-year module on banking and financial institutions/financial landscape or as an opener to a core financial management course on strategic options, investment strategy, and value creation.Describe the evolution of the fintech landscape and the various companies involved; Analyze the environmental conditions that have led to the popularity of fintech and determine where fintech is in a cycle of development; Consider the impact of fintech on traditional banks and financial institutions broadly and determine appropriate responses from banks/financial institutions in the wake of fintech; Explore efforts to regulate the growing fintech industry; Predict which business areas and product types could be tapped for fintech growth; Develop an awareness of the magnitude of capital investments and acquisitions in/of fintech companies; Defend an appropriate strategy for an incumbent financial institution to use regarding fintech; Consider the role of traditional commercial banks, investment banks, and fintech companies for economies and society at large.
